package org.eclipse.wst.xml.vex.core.internal.layout;
import org.eclipse.wst.xml.vex.core.internal.dom.Element;
/**
* Represents a line of text and inline images.
*/
public class LineBox extends CompositeInlineBox {
private Element element;
private InlineBox[] children;
private InlineBox firstContentChild = null;
private InlineBox lastContentChild = null;
private int baseline;
/**
* Class constructor.
*
* @param context
* LayoutContext for this layout.
* @param children
* InlineBoxes that make up this line.
*/
public LineBox(LayoutContext context, Element element, InlineBox[] children) {
this.element = element;
this.children = children;
int height = 0;
int x = 0;
this.baseline = 0;
for (int i = 0; i < children.length; i++) {
InlineBox child = children[i];
child.setX(x);
child.setY(0); // TODO: do proper vertical alignment
this.baseline = Math.max(this.baseline, child.getBaseline());
x += child.getWidth();
height = Math.max(height, child.getHeight());
if (child.hasContent()) {
if (this.firstContentChild == null) {
this.firstContentChild = child;
}
this.lastContentChild = child;
}
}
this.setHeight(height);
this.setWidth(x);
}
/**
* @see org.eclipse.wst.xml.vex.core.internal.layout.InlineBox#getBaseline()
*/
public int getBaseline() {
return this.baseline;
}
public Box[] getChildren() {
return this.children;
}
/**
* @see org.eclipse.wst.xml.vex.core.internal.layout.Box#getElement()
*/
public Element getElement() {
return this.element;
}
/**
* @see org.eclipse.wst.xml.vex.core.internal.layout.Box#getEndOffset()
*/
public int getEndOffset() {
return this.lastContentChild.getEndOffset();
}
/**
* @see org.eclipse.wst.xml.vex.core.internal.layout.Box#getStartOffset()
*/
public int getStartOffset() {
return this.firstContentChild.getStartOffset();
}
/**
* @see org.eclipse.wst.xml.vex.core.internal.layout.Box#hasContent()
*/
public boolean hasContent() {
return this.firstContentChild != null;
}
/**
* @see org.eclipse.wst.xml.vex.core.internal.layout.CompositeInlineBox#split(org.eclipse.wst.xml.vex.core.internal.layout.LayoutContext,
* org.eclipse.wst.xml.vex.core.internal.layout.InlineBox[],
* org.eclipse.wst.xml.vex.core.internal.layout.InlineBox[])
*/
public Pair split(LayoutContext context, InlineBox[] lefts,
InlineBox[] rights) {
LineBox left = null;
LineBox right = null;
if (lefts.length > 0) {
left = new LineBox(context, this.getElement(), lefts);
}
if (rights.length > 0) {
right = new LineBox(context, this.getElement(), rights);
}
return new Pair(left, right);
}
/**
* @see java.lang.Object#toString()
*/
public String toString() {
Box[] children = this.getChildren();
StringBuffer sb = new StringBuffer();
for (int i = 0; i < children.length; i++) {
sb.append(children[i]);
}
return sb.toString();
}
// ========================================================== PRIVATE
}
